Through the gate! Anderson barely celebrates, as it’s only the nightwatchman, but it’s better than nothing. And, for once, Australia have lost two wickets before reaching 50.

18th over: Australia 48-1 (Harris 23, Neser 3) Broad is fuller and faster than he sometimes at the start of a spell. And the first ball almost produces a wicket! Michael Neser drove it into the covers, where Haseeb Hameed swooped and pulled off a direct hit at the striker’s end. Marcus Harris, flat out, just made his ground. England have a new plan: getting ’em in run-outs.
